Nginx配置密码访问,访问网页需输入用户名密码

这个实现的原理就是创建虚拟用户,在nginx的配置文件中指定生成的用户密码文件,当访问网页时就会弹出提示输入用户密码的提示,然输入正确的用户密码就可以访问。否则无法访问。
一.安装nginx
可参考文章安装nginx

二.安装密码生成工具

Nginx配置密码访问,访问网页需输入用户名密码

2.1生成用户和密码文件

Nginx配置密码访问,访问网页需输入用户名密码

参数说明
web01 是自定义用户
password 是密码文件

回车后,输入用户名的密码,就完成了文件的生成。

2.2查看生成的用户和密码

Nginx配置密码访问,访问网页需输入用户名密码

2.3对用户的操作方法

2.3.1删除用户和密码

Nginx配置密码访问,访问网页需输入用户名密码

2.3.2修改用户和密码

Nginx配置密码访问,访问网页需输入用户名密码

2.4修改nginx配置

Nginx配置密码访问,访问网页需输入用户名密码

2.5重启服务

Nginx配置密码访问,访问网页需输入用户名密码

Nginx配置密码访问,访问网页需输入用户名密码

原文地址:https://blog.csdn.net/Rio520/article/details/115589224

Original: https://www.cnblogs.com/ccdr/p/16257848.html
Author: 车车大人
Title: Nginx配置密码访问,访问网页需输入用户名密码

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/543723/

转载文章受原作者版权保护。转载请注明原作者出处!

(0)

大家都在看

  • RuoYi(若依)前后端分离版本,windows下部署(nginx)

    上一篇用了tomcat部署(https://blog.csdn.net/yueyekkx/article/details/105491363),还是觉得nginx是王道话不多说开始…

    Java 2023年5月30日
    065
  • pwnkit漏洞分析-CVE-2021-4034

    研究了一下前段时间的Polkit提权漏洞,里面有很多以前不知道的技巧。漏洞很好用,通杀CENTOS、UBUNTU各版本。 主要是分析这个POC触发原理。POC如下: /* * Pr…

    Java 2023年6月5日
    067
  • LeetCode.1175-质数排列(Prime Arrangements)

    这是小川的第 413次更新,第 446篇原创 看题和准备 今天介绍的是 LeetCode算法题中 Easy级别的第 264题(顺位题号是 1175)。返回1到 n的排列数,以使质数…

    Java 2023年6月5日
    069
  • java学习指北

    尚硅谷java语法:https://blog.csdn.net/PorkBird/article/details/113666542 尚硅谷JVM:https://github.c…

    Java 2023年5月29日
    070
  • Web服务器和Tomcat

    2、web服务器 2.1、技术讲解 ASP: 微软:国内最早流行的就是ASP; 在HTML中嵌入了VB的脚本, ASP + COM; 在ASP开发中,基本一个页面都有几千行的业务代…

    Java 2023年6月8日
    067
  • 4、spring+springMVC+mybaits+idea+maven

    1、构建项目结构如下 2、构建项目中的pom.xml文件中的依赖资源,里面包含ajax和分页插件的依赖哦 1 <?xml version="1.0" en…

    Java 2023年6月13日
    054
  • Oracle 报错 ORA-01843: not a valid month

    在导入SQL文件是出现,表导入正确,但是数据没有成功导入。 1,先找问题所在: 复制一个insert的语句在Navicat进行测试,出现报错。 ORA-01843: not a v…

    Java 2023年6月5日
    077
  • HTML5笔记:跨域通讯、多线程、本地存储和多图片上传技术

    最近做项目在前端我使用了很多新技术,这些技术有bootstrap、angularjs,不过最让我兴奋的还是使用了HTML5的技术,今天我想总结一些HTML5的技术,好记性不如烂笔头…

    Java 2023年5月29日
    093
  • linux下安装jdk8

    1、下载jdk8安装包 2、拷贝到指定目录下(比如:/usr/package) 3、解压到安装目录下(比如:/usr/soft/java) tar -zxvf jdk-8u121-…

    Java 2023年6月8日
    065
  • 第七周总结-vue脚手架整合SSM-路由配置

    使用axios异步 用户列表 编号 姓名 年&#x9F…

    Java 2023年6月7日
    091
  • 设计模式之解释器模式

    解释器模式属于行为型模式;指给分析对象定义一个语言,并定义该语言的文法表示,再设计一个解析器来解释语言中的句子。也就是说,用编译语言的方式来分析应用中的实例。这种模式实现了文法表达…

    Java 2023年6月5日
    066
  • 设计模式 18 中介者模式

    中介者模式(Mediator Pattern)属于 行为型模式 一提到中介,大家都非常熟悉,生活中最常见的就是房屋中介。 虽然中介要收取一定费用,但却能给房东和租客都提供大量遍历,…

    Java 2023年6月6日
    099
  • PotPlayer播放百度云盘视频

    需要的工具 PotPlayer、油猴tampermonkey、坚果(这个不用下载,有个账号就行)下载地址:百度网盘 步骤 安装油猴tampermonkey 拖拽 Tampermon…

    Java 2023年6月9日
    0234
  • 面向对象设计六大原则

    六大设计原则主要是指: 单一职责原则(Single Responsibility Principle); 开闭原则(Open Closed Principle); 里氏替换原则(L…

    Java 2023年6月9日
    065
  • SpringMVC学习笔记

    本文转载自尚硅谷杨博超老师的笔记,视频链接–>哔哩哔哩 一、SpringMVC简介 1、什么是MVC MVC是一种软件架构的思想,将软件按照模型、视图、控制器来划…

    Java 2023年6月8日
    069
  • 咕泡学院高级架构师全套课程

    百度网盘分享链接: https://pan.baidu.com/s/1yFtiPsIcDGFyELJHl4wjQg视频也是从网上找了好久才找的的。我看了一部分,感觉不同,同事也说高…

    Java 2023年6月6日
    091
亲爱的 Coder【最近整理,可免费获取】👉 最新必读书单  | 👏 面试题下载  | 🌎 免费的AI知识星球